Output 76849423ef4039214a170564f8f61bdd933230bf06cff8e01c5977018b7ea280:1

value
3414436
script pubkey
OP_0 OP_PUSHBYTES_20 ea453661da6c29dd44fddd305e4b4643aac18746
address
bc1qafznvcw6ds5a638am5c9uj6xgw4vrp6xv76f8f
transaction
76849423ef4039214a170564f8f61bdd933230bf06cff8e01c5977018b7ea280